Nigerians Qualify As UK Launches Visa Scheme For Skilled Workers

by Folarin Kehinde August 24, 2022
written by Folarin Kehinde

The United Kingdom has announced that skilled foreign nationals can now apply for its worker scale up -visa program.

A scale-up worker visa is a visa route that allows people come to the UK to do an eligible job for a fast-growing UK business.

According to a statement on the www.gov.uk website, foreign nationals are now eligible to apply for the visa effective 22nd August.

The professions qualified to apply for the scale-up visa include: Scientists, Engineers, Programmers, Software Developers, Research and Development Professionals, Economists, Architects, Technicians, and Financial and Investment Advisers.

Applicants granted the scale-up visa are eligible to stay in the UK for 2 years. However, when the 2 years visa expire, they can extend their visa by 3 years for as long as possible.

According to a statement issued by the British government, the development would see growing businesses attract the right talent to enhance productivity across the economy as it is believed that scaling up is an important phase for high-growth businesses to continue growing and drive their international competitiveness.

The exercise is expected to see talent across various fields such as science, engineering, and programming as it brings in sought-after expertise and skills, enterprises that can boost their innovation and productivity and in turn keep contributing to the UK’s economy.

Nigerians and citizens of other countries are eligible to apply for the Visa programme as it is an opportunity for career advancement and experience.
